.kc-sec{--kc-scarlet:#9e1c20;--kc-scarlet-dark:#7d1518;--kc-ink:#1d1d1f;--kc-slate:#4a4a4f;--kc-cloud:#f6f4f2;--kc-line:#e4ded9;--kc-gold:#c8862a;--kc-white:#fff;--kc-maxw:1120px;--kc-r:14px;--kc-sans:-apple-system,BlinkMacSystemFont,"Segoe UI",Roboto,Helvetica,Arial,sans-serif;font-family:var(--kc-sans);color:var(--kc-ink);line-height:1.6;-webkit-font-smoothing:antialiased}.kc-sec,.kc-sec *{box-sizing:border-box}.kc-sec{padding:68px 0;background:var(--kc-white)}.kc-wrap{max-width:var(--kc-maxw);margin:0 auto;padding:0 24px}.kc-sec h1,.kc-sec h2,.kc-sec h3{line-height:1.15;letter-spacing:-.01em}.kc-sec h2{font-size:clamp(1.6rem,3.4vw,2.4rem);margin-bottom:.5em}.kc-sec h3{font-size:1.2rem;margin-bottom:.35em}.kc-sec p{margin-bottom:1em}.kc-sec a{color:var(--kc-scarlet)}.kc-sec ul,.kc-sec li{margin:0}.kc-eyebrow{display:block;text-transform:uppercase;letter-spacing:.14em;font-size:.74rem;font-weight:700;color:var(--kc-scarlet)}.kc-micro{font-size:.86rem;color:var(--kc-slate)}.kc-center{text-align:center}.kc-lede{font-size:1.05rem;color:var(--kc-slate);max-width:760px}.kc-sec .kc-btn{display:inline-block;background:var(--kc-scarlet);color:#fff;text-decoration:none;font-weight:700;padding:15px 28px;border-radius:999px;font-size:1.02rem;transition:.15s;border:2px solid var(--kc-scarlet);cursor:pointer}.kc-sec .kc-btn:hover{background:var(--kc-scarlet-dark);border-color:var(--kc-scarlet-dark);color:#fff}.kc-sec .kc-btn.kc-ghost{background:transparent;color:var(--kc-scarlet)}.kc-sec .kc-btn.kc-ghost:hover{background:var(--kc-scarlet);color:#fff}.kc-sec .kc-btn.kc-small{padding:11px 20px;font-size:.92rem}.kc-cta-row{display:flex;flex-wrap:wrap;gap:14px;align-items:center}.kc-ph{display:flex;align-items:center;justify-content:center;text-align:center;flex-direction:column;background:repeating-linear-gradient(45deg,#efe9e4,#efe9e4 12px,#e8e0d9 12px 24px);color:#8a7d72;border:1px dashed #c9bcb0;border-radius:var(--kc-r);font-size:.82rem;padding:18px;min-height:200px;font-weight:600}.kc-ph small{display:block;font-weight:400;margin-top:6px;color:#a89c90}.kc-imgwrap img{width:100%;height:auto;border-radius:var(--kc-r);display:block}.kc-hero{background:linear-gradient(180deg,#fbf9f7,#f2ece6)}.kc-hero .kc-wrap{display:grid;grid-template-columns:1.05fr .95fr;gap:48px;align-items:center;padding-top:64px;padding-bottom:64px}.kc-hero h1{font-size:clamp(2.1rem,4.6vw,3.3rem);margin-bottom:.45em}.kc-hero p.kc-lead{font-size:1.16rem;color:var(--kc-slate);margin-bottom:1.4em}.kc-hero .kc-imgwrap img{box-shadow:0 18px 50px #0000001f}.kc-credit{margin-top:14px;font-weight:700;color:var(--kc-scarlet)}.kc-banner{background:var(--kc-ink);color:#fff;text-align:center;padding:30px 0}.kc-banner p{font-size:clamp(1.15rem,2.6vw,1.6rem);font-weight:700;margin:0;letter-spacing:-.01em}.kc-banner small{display:block;font-weight:400;color:#c9c6c2;margin-top:6px;font-size:.92rem}.kc-grid4{display:grid;grid-template-columns:repeat(4,1fr);gap:22px}.kc-step{background:var(--kc-cloud);border:1px solid var(--kc-line);border-radius:var(--kc-r);padding:26px}.kc-step .kc-num{display:inline-flex;align-items:center;justify-content:center;width:34px;height:34px;border-radius:50%;background:var(--kc-scarlet);color:#fff;font-weight:800;margin-bottom:12px}.kc-paths{display:grid;grid-template-columns:1fr 1fr;gap:22px;margin-top:24px}.kc-path{border:2px solid var(--kc-line);border-radius:var(--kc-r);padding:26px}.kc-path.kc-lead{border-color:var(--kc-scarlet)}.kc-split{display:grid;grid-template-columns:1fr 1fr;gap:44px;align-items:center}.kc-chips{display:flex;flex-wrap:wrap;gap:10px;margin:18px 0}.kc-chip{background:var(--kc-cloud);border:1px solid var(--kc-line);border-radius:999px;padding:8px 16px;font-size:.92rem;font-weight:600}.kc-cols2{columns:2;gap:30px}.kc-cols2 li{margin-bottom:6px}ul.kc-clean{list-style:none}ul.kc-clean li{padding-left:26px;position:relative;margin-bottom:8px}ul.kc-clean li:before{content:"";position:absolute;left:0;top:.55em;width:12px;height:12px;border-radius:50%;background:var(--kc-scarlet);opacity:.85}.kc-amber{background:#fff8e6;border:1px solid #f0dca0;color:#6b5418;border-radius:12px;padding:14px 18px;font-size:.92rem;margin-top:22px;max-width:760px}.kc-pricewrap{background:var(--kc-cloud)}table.kc-rate{width:100%;border-collapse:collapse;background:#fff;border-radius:var(--kc-r);overflow:hidden;border:1px solid var(--kc-line)}table.kc-rate th,table.kc-rate td{padding:16px 18px;text-align:left;border-bottom:1px solid var(--kc-line);vertical-align:top}table.kc-rate th{background:var(--kc-ink);color:#fff;font-size:.82rem;text-transform:uppercase;letter-spacing:.08em}table.kc-rate tr:last-child td{border-bottom:none}table.kc-rate .kc-price{font-weight:800;color:var(--kc-scarlet);white-space:nowrap}.kc-feature{display:grid;grid-template-columns:1fr 1fr;gap:44px;align-items:center}.kc-feature.kc-flip .kc-media{order:2}.kc-cardrow{display:grid;grid-template-columns:1fr 1fr;gap:22px;margin-top:20px}.kc-card{border:1px solid var(--kc-line);border-radius:var(--kc-r);padding:24px;background:#fff}.kc-trust{background:var(--kc-ink);color:#fff}.kc-trust h2{color:#fff}.kc-trust .kc-grid4{margin-top:10px}.kc-trust .kc-t{background:#26262a;border:1px solid #34343a;border-radius:var(--kc-r);padding:22px;color:#e9e6e2}.kc-trust .kc-t strong{color:#fff}.kc-sec details{border:1px solid var(--kc-line);border-radius:12px;padding:4px 18px;margin-bottom:12px;background:#fff}.kc-sec details summary{cursor:pointer;font-weight:700;padding:14px 0;list-style:none}.kc-sec details summary::-webkit-details-marker{display:none}.kc-sec details summary:after{content:"+";float:right;color:var(--kc-scarlet);font-weight:800;font-size:1.2rem}.kc-sec details[open] summary:after{content:"\2013"}.kc-sec details .kc-a{padding-bottom:16px;color:var(--kc-slate)}.kc-sec details .kc-a p{margin-bottom:.7em}.kc-final{background:linear-gradient(135deg,var(--kc-scarlet),var(--kc-scarlet-dark));color:#fff;text-align:center}.kc-final h2{color:#fff}.kc-sec.kc-final .kc-btn{background:#fff;color:var(--kc-scarlet);border-color:#fff}.kc-sec.kc-final .kc-btn:hover{background:#f1e9e9;color:var(--kc-scarlet)}.kc-sec.kc-final .kc-btn.kc-ghost{background:transparent;color:#fff;border-color:#fff}.kc-sec.kc-final .kc-btn.kc-ghost:hover{background:#fff;color:var(--kc-scarlet)}.kc-final a.kc-phone{color:#fff;font-weight:700}.kc-vgrid{display:grid;grid-template-columns:repeat(3,1fr);gap:24px;margin-top:8px}.kc-video{position:relative;aspect-ratio:16/9;border-radius:12px;overflow:hidden;background:#000;box-shadow:0 8px 24px #0000001a}.kc-video iframe,.kc-video video{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;border:0}.kc-video video{object-fit:cover}.kc-vcard h3{font-size:1.04rem;margin:.7em 0 .15em}.kc-vcard p{font-size:.9rem;color:var(--kc-slate);margin:0}.kc-tag{display:inline-block;font-size:.72rem;font-weight:700;text-transform:uppercase;letter-spacing:.08em;color:var(--kc-scarlet);margin-bottom:.2em}.kc-sectionhead{display:flex;align-items:baseline;justify-content:space-between;gap:16px;flex-wrap:wrap;margin-bottom:18px}.kc-note{background:#fff8e6;border:1px solid #f0dca0;color:#6b5418;border-radius:12px;padding:14px 18px;font-size:.92rem;margin:22px 0}.kc-note strong{color:#7a5e16}.kc-cta-band{background:var(--kc-cloud);border:1px solid var(--kc-line);border-radius:var(--kc-r);padding:26px 28px;display:flex;align-items:center;justify-content:space-between;gap:20px;flex-wrap:wrap;margin-top:26px}.kc-cta-band p{margin:0}.kc-clips{display:grid;grid-template-columns:repeat(4,1fr);gap:18px;margin-top:18px}.kc-clip .kc-video{aspect-ratio:16/9}.kc-clip h3{font-size:.92rem;margin:.5em 0 0}.kc-course{background:var(--kc-ink);color:#eee;border-radius:var(--kc-r);padding:34px 36px;display:grid;grid-template-columns:1.3fr 1fr;gap:32px;align-items:center}.kc-course h2{color:#fff}.kc-course .kc-micro{color:#c9c6c2}.kc-sec .kc-course .kc-btn{background:#fff;color:var(--kc-scarlet);border-color:#fff}.kc-sec .kc-course .kc-btn:hover{background:#efe2e2;color:var(--kc-scarlet)}.kc-pill{display:inline-block;background:#2a2a2e;border:1px solid #3a3a40;color:#e9e6e2;border-radius:999px;padding:6px 14px;font-size:.82rem;margin:3px 4px 3px 0}@media(max-width:900px){.kc-vgrid,.kc-clips{grid-template-columns:repeat(2,1fr)}.kc-course{grid-template-columns:1fr}}@media(max-width:880px){.kc-hero .kc-wrap,.kc-split,.kc-feature,.kc-paths,.kc-cardrow{grid-template-columns:1fr}.kc-feature.kc-flip .kc-media{order:0}.kc-grid4{grid-template-columns:1fr 1fr}.kc-cols2{columns:1}.kc-sec{padding:48px 0}}@media(max-width:560px){.kc-grid4,.kc-vgrid,.kc-clips{grid-template-columns:1fr}}
/*# sourceMappingURL=/cdn/shop/t/56/assets/kiln-care.css.map */
